What the ExpireMate logo means, and the decisions behind it.
You already have your mechanism. For it to keep repeating, it needs a system that drives it. That is ExpireMate.
So the logo is not two objects standing next to each other. It is a single ring: one half is a toothed gear, and that same ring carries on as an arrow that sweeps the rest of the circle and points back into the teeth. The gear is your work. The arrow is what brings it round again.
Three elements, and the line between them is the whole idea: one half is yours, the other is ours.
The visits, the parts, the annual service. You built this half, and it was turning long before we arrived. That is why it is drawn in white: it is yours, not ours.
This is where we come in. The arrow continues your ring instead of standing beside it, because a reminder is not a separate tool bolted on the side. It is what carries one service round to the next, so the customer who would have quietly drifted away comes back instead.
A gear mounted on nothing does not turn, it drifts. The pivot is the fixed point your work is seated on: the dates, the reminders and the service history, in one place.
Which is why the colour sits on the arrow and not on the gear. White is your work, green is our part in it, and you can see at a glance where one ends and the other begins.
